Sharing the Love - Local Funds for Local Women
It's really all about seeing their faces and knowing their names, these women whose lives you've helped change. To see them radiate confidence, believing that they now have worth, that they now can improve their lives and stand on their own two feet reinforces the fact that you personally are helping change the world. In order to stay connected to these real women you help, it has to be all about local funds for local women. The world has become such a hugely interconnected economy and market place in which donated funds can easily be sucked up, disappearing into enormous organizations which you can only hope will put them to good use, somehow, somewhere. The Girlfriend Factor knows it doesn't have to be that way. Funds raised by us in a community stay in that community. You donate a dollar to GFF, the whole dollar goes to a specific woman going to a specific school in your own community, eager to get a job within your local economy. When a woman becomes a productive citizen in the workforce we all win. We now have local funds helping local women in the Greater Palm Springs area and San Francisco, CA and Port Angeles, WA.
